The landscape of the Internet of Things (IoT) is vast and varied, offering an array of connectivity options tailored to totally different use instances. In this complicated ecosystem, the choice between cellular and non-cellular IoT connectivity performs a pivotal function in figuring out the success of IoT deployments.


Cellular IoT connectivity makes use of current cellular networks to facilitate communication. Managed IoT Connectivity. This know-how leverages the infrastructure of established cellular services, thereby guaranteeing wide coverage and excessive data switch rates. The comfort of utilizing cellular networks implies that in depth geographical areas may be lined without the necessity for laying new cables or deploying further infrastructure.


One of the significant benefits of cellular connectivity is its proven reliability. Networks have been optimized through the years, guaranteeing that they will deal with a giant quantity of related devices concurrently. In environments where constant and reliable efficiency is crucial, cellular IoT supplies a solid basis, particularly for purposes like telemedicine, vehicle monitoring, or smart metropolis solutions.

Conversely, non-cellular IoT connectivity refers to technologies like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, Zigbee, and LPWAN. These choices typically function in short-range scenarios and are sometimes designed for particular applications. They allow for the establishment of native networks that may achieve high-speed data transfers but with restricted vary. This can make them an excellent selection for applications confined to a specific area, like residence automation or industrial monitoring within a factory.


The selection between these two connectivity varieties primarily hinges on the necessities of the precise application. For example, a wise meter deployed in a remote location could significantly benefit from cellular connectivity as a end result of prolonged vary and ability to transmit data over longer distances. On the other hand, a wise residence gadget, which operates inside a confined house, would possibly utilize Wi-Fi or Bluetooth, given their capability to offer robust local connectivity at lower costs.


Moreover, energy consumption varies considerably between cellular and non-cellular technologies. Cellular units, whereas increasingly efficient, generally consume more power compared to their non-cellular counterparts. This is a important consideration for battery-powered gadgets that goal to function for prolonged intervals while not having frequent recharges or battery replacements. Non-cellular technologies usually permit for energy-saving modes which may prolong operational life, making them ideal for applications the place longevity is paramount.

Cost elements also play a significant function in making a call between cellular and non-cellular connectivity. The deployment of cellular IoT units typically entails service plans that incorporate ongoing subscription prices. In distinction, non-cellular options may require an upfront funding in infrastructure, but they can lead to lower operational costs in the lengthy run.


Security considerations arise distinctly in each kinds of connectivity. Cellular networks supply a level of built-in security due to their closed nature and reliance on established protocols. Encryption and authentication processes are usually strong, making it difficult for unauthorized customers to entry the network. Non-cellular technologies, whereas convenient, can potentially expose units to increased security dangers, especially in open networks like public Wi-Fi - Aws IoT Connectivity.


The scalability of an IoT system is another factor to assume about when deciding on connectivity choices. Cellular networks have a tendency to supply greater scalability as a end result of their capacity to accommodate a big volume of units over extensive areas. This is especially beneficial for enterprises looking to broaden their IoT deployments without the need to overhaul present infrastructure.

Non-cellular networks can even scale, however they're usually restricted by vary and information dealing with capabilities. In congested environments or densely populated areas, the efficiency of non-cellular options may diminish, creating bottlenecks that could affect the overall efficiency of an IoT ecosystem. This contrast can have an result on the long-term viability of an answer relying on the anticipated development and complexity of the application.


Latency is a crucial element that distinguishes cellular and non-cellular IoT connectivity. Cellular networks have improved significantly over recent years, however latency can nonetheless be greater in comparability with some non-cellular options. For purposes requiring real-time responses, similar to autonomous driving or industrial automation, lower latency connections are essential. In such cases, edge computing mixed with non-cellular technologies may provide the necessary response times.
